Nanotechnology and nanomedicine: a primer
Bailus Walker1, Charles P Mouton
1Department of Community and Family Medicine, Howard University College of Medicine, Washington, DC 20059, USA. bwalker@howard.edu
Abstract:
Nanosciences and nanotechnology are transforming a wide array of products and services that have the potential to enhance the practice of medicine and improve public health. But there are a number of health, safety and environmental issues to be addressed. This review summarizes some basic facts about nanotechnology and cites examples of its application to medicine and public health.
